A wanted to follow up from Sunday’s message regarding fasting.
Fasting causes you to become more fruitful. (See Joel 2:22.)
Fasting increases the fruit of a believer’s life. This includes the fruit of the Spirit. God desires His people to be more fruitful. Fasting helps our ministries, businesses, and careers become more fruitful.
Fasting releases the rain. (See Joel 2:23.)
Rain represents the outpouring of the Holy Spirit. Rain also represents blessing and refreshing. Israel needed the former rain to moisten the ground for planting. They needed the latter rain to bring the crops to maturity. God has promised to give the former and latter rains in response to fasting.
Fasting moistens the ground (the heart) for the planting of the seed (the Word of God). Fasting causes the rain to fall in dry places. If you have not experienced revival in your spirit for a long time, through fasting the Lord can cause the rain of revival to fall in your life so that you can be refreshed and renewed.
Fasting breaks limitations, releases favor, and brings enlargement. (See Esther 4:14–16.)
Fasting was a part of defeating the plans of Haman to destroy the Jews. The whole nation of Israel was delivered because of fasting. Esther needed favor from the king and received it as a result of fasting. Fasting releases favor and brings great deliverance. The Jews not only defeated their enemies but they were also enlarged. Mordecai was promoted, and Haman was hung.
Enlargement comes through fasting. Fasting breaks limitations and gives you more room to expand and grow. God desires to enlarge our borders (Deut. 12:20). God wants us to have more territory. This includes natural and spiritual territory. Fasting breaks limitations and causes expansion.
Fasting will cause you to have great victory against overwhelming odds. (See 2 Chronicles 20:3.)
Jehoshaphat was facing the combined armies of Moab, Ammon, and Edom. He was facing overwhelming odds. Fasting helped him to defeat these enemies. Fasting helps us to have victory in the midst of defeat.
Jehoshaphat called a fast because he was afraid. Fear is another stronghold that many believers have difficulty overcoming. Fasting will break the power of the demon of fear. Spirits of terror, panic, fright, apprehension, and timidity can be overcome through fasting. Freedom from fear is a requirement to live a victorious lifestyle.
